Hey look what I did with my scraps - Kids Chair
By Mike Smith, Ravenswood

My last two projects were built out of maple plywood.

I had accumulated too much scrap.

I used almost all the leftovers to make these infant chairs.

It feels good to clean out the shop (my garage) and put the scrap to good use.

I copied the design from Community Playthings .

They have these chairs at my son's daycare.
So I just traced the outline on some construction paper.

Hope this helps with the dimensions.
I took out my protractor and looks like the pitch to the seat back is about 97 degrees.

All joinery is dadoes reinforced with glue and
1-1/4"   #6 woodscrews.

And the final test is made by Cohen Smith...   Appears to have been approved!
